  • there is a "Difference" from using your wrist to blast by actually pushing the stick and pulling it... and using your wrist to control the hit by slightly moving it.

  • If you were to throw something up in the air in front of you how do you catch it? by just holding your arms out? or do you catch it and move your arms down just a bit to control it.? Exactly my point. Dont use your wrist to blast.
